Galera (Fr.) P. Kumm. 1871
Pileus regular, thin, often striate, margin straight and pressed to the stem when young; gills adnate, becoming almost free during expansion; stem central; spores rusty-ochre.
Most closely allied to Naucoria, but distinguished by the thin pileus, having the pileus straight when young. Corresponds in structure with Mycena and Nolanea. Growing on the ground.
